What Factors Should You Consider When Choosing Spark Plug Wires for a 1984 Corvette?

When choosing spark plug wires for a 1984 Corvette, several key factors should be considered to ensure optimal performance and compatibility.

  • Material: The material of the spark plug wires can significantly affect their durability and performance. Wires made from high-quality silicone or rubber insulation are typically more resistant to heat and wear, ensuring a longer lifespan and better conductivity.
  • Resistance: The resistance level of the spark plug wires is crucial as it impacts the electrical flow to the spark plugs. Low-resistance wires are generally preferred for performance vehicles like the Corvette, as they allow for quicker and more efficient delivery of the electrical signal.
  • Length and Fit: The length of the spark plug wires must be appropriate for the engine layout of the 1984 Corvette. Properly fitting wires prevent loose connections and ensure that the electrical signal travels efficiently, reducing the risk of misfires.
  • Brand Reputation: Choosing a reputable brand can make a significant difference in quality and reliability. Established brands often provide better warranties and user reviews, indicating their performance in real-world applications.
  • Heat Resistance: Since the engine generates a lot of heat, spark plug wires must be able to withstand high temperatures without degrading. Wires designed with heat-resistant materials are essential to prevent failures that could lead to engine performance issues.
  • Connector Type: The connectors on the spark plug wires should match the specifications of the 1984 Corvette’s ignition system. Mismatched connectors can lead to improper seating, which may cause electrical issues or even engine misfires.

What Symptoms Indicate Worn or Damaged Spark Plug Wires in a 1984 Corvette?

Rough idling is another symptom where the engine vibrates excessively or runs unevenly when stationary, a direct result of misfiring cylinders due to ineffective spark plug wire functioning. This often leads to driver discomfort and may cause additional wear on engine components.

Reduced acceleration can be frustrating for drivers, as it indicates that the engine is not performing to its full potential. Worn spark plug wires can hinder the ignition process, resulting in delayed throttle response and sluggish performance.

Increased fuel consumption often accompanies worn spark plug wires because the engine has to work harder to compensate for the inefficiencies in combustion. This can lead to higher operational costs and reduced fuel economy.

Finally, visible damage to the spark plug wires should never be ignored; cracks or burns can expose the wires to further degradation and could potentially lead to complete failure during operation. Regular visual inspections can help catch these issues early.

What Steps Should You Follow to Properly Install Spark Plug Wires on a 1984 Corvette?

To properly install spark plug wires on a 1984 Corvette, follow these essential steps:

  • Gather Necessary Tools: Ensure you have the right tools before starting the installation process, including a socket wrench, spark plug wire pliers, and possibly a torque wrench.
  • Disconnect the Battery: For safety, disconnect the negative terminal of the battery to prevent any electrical shorts or shocks while working on the ignition system.
  • Remove Old Wires: Carefully remove the old spark plug wires one at a time to avoid mixing them up, starting from the engine and moving toward the distributor, using pliers if necessary.
  • Inspect Spark Plugs: Before installing the new wires, check the condition of the spark plugs to ensure they are in good shape; replace them if they show signs of wear or damage.
  • Install New Wires: Begin installing the new spark plug wires by connecting each wire to its respective spark plug, making sure to follow the firing order of the engine, typically 1-8-4-3-6-5-7-2 for the 1984 Corvette.
  • Route Wires Correctly: Route the spark plug wires away from hot surfaces and moving parts, securing them with clips or ties to prevent chafing and interference with other components.
  • Reconnect the Battery: Once all wires are installed, reconnect the negative terminal of the battery and ensure everything is secure before starting the engine.
  • Test the Installation: Start the engine to check for smooth operation; listen for any misfires or irregular sounds that may indicate a problem with the connections.

What Maintenance Practices Help Extend the Life of Spark Plug Wires in a 1984 Corvette?

Several maintenance practices can help extend the life of spark plug wires in a 1984 Corvette:

  • Regular Inspection: Regularly checking your spark plug wires for signs of wear or damage, such as fraying, cracking, or corrosion, can help you catch issues before they lead to failure.
  • Proper Routing: Ensure that spark plug wires are routed correctly and not in contact with hot engine components, which can lead to premature degradation.
  • Cleaning Connections: Keeping the connections at both the spark plugs and ignition coil clean and free of corrosion can improve conductivity and reduce the risk of misfires.
  • Use of Quality Wires: Investing in high-quality spark plug wires specifically designed for the 1984 Corvette can enhance performance and longevity compared to generic options.
  • Routine Maintenance Schedule: Incorporating spark plug wire checks into your regular vehicle maintenance schedule can help ensure they are replaced as needed before they cause performance issues.

Regular inspection of the wires allows you to identify any physical damage early on, which is crucial for maintaining optimal engine performance. Look for any signs like discoloration or brittleness that indicate the wires might need replacement.

Proper routing is essential because spark plug wires can get damaged if they come into contact with hot engine components like the exhaust manifold. Keeping them secured away from these areas significantly reduces the risk of heat-related deterioration.

Cleaning connections at the ends of the spark plug wires helps maintain good electrical contact. Dirt and corrosion can hinder the flow of electricity, leading to misfires or rough engine performance, so regular cleaning is advisable.

Using high-quality spark plug wires that are specifically made for the 1984 Corvette can ensure compatibility and reliability. These wires are typically designed to withstand the specific thermal and electrical demands of the engine.

Incorporating checks of your spark plug wires into a routine maintenance schedule can prevent unexpected issues. By keeping track of their condition, you can proactively replace them before they impact your vehicle’s performance.
